As a graduate-level international policy school, we offer master’s and Ph.D. programs focusing on public policy, development policy, and public management. The normal class teaching load is four courses per year spread out over three trimesters and courses are taught in English. The School provides internationally competitive compensation, faculty housing options (when available), child education benefits (where applicable), moving expense support, generous research funding opportunities, and conference travel support.

KDI School is one of the leading academic and research institutions in Korea and Asia, offering a unique educational experience that prepares the next generation of leaders in today’s rapidly changing and globalizing world. The KDI School campus offers unparalleled access to South Korea’s policy and research leaders, given its location in the city of Sejong, the administrative capital of South Korea, and home to the National Research Complex that incorporates sixteen leading national policy research institutes. Geographically situated at the center of South Korea, Sejong is connected to Seoul via a high-speed train system with about an hour of travel time, and to all of the other major cities with a travel time of less than two hours.
